Flowerbed curbing installation involves creating a defined border around garden beds to enhance the appearance and structure of outdoor spaces. This service typically includes the placement of durable materials such as concrete, brick, stone, or plastic edging that helps contain mulch, soil, and plants within the designated area. Properly installed flowerbed curbing not only improves curb appeal but also provides a clear separation between lawn and garden, making maintenance easier and more efficient. Many homeowners choose to invest in this service to achieve a neat, organized look that elevates the overall aesthetic of their landscaping.

One common problem that flowerbed curbing addresses is the issue of garden beds becoming overgrown or blending into the lawn over time. Without a defined border, grass can encroach into flowerbeds, making them harder to maintain and potentially damaging the plants. Additionally, loose or uneven edges can cause mulch or soil to spill onto the lawn, creating a messy appearance. Installing a sturdy curb prevents these issues by providing a reliable barrier that keeps garden beds tidy and contained, reducing the need for frequent trimming and clean-up.

This service is often used on residential properties, especially those with landscaped front yards, backyard gardens, or decorative flowerbeds. It is suitable for homes that want to improve their curb appeal or make their outdoor spaces more functional. Properties with uneven terrain or areas prone to erosion can also benefit from flowerbed curbing, as it helps stabilize the edges and prevent soil from washing away. The overview below groups typical Flowerbed Curbing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Brandon, MS.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or flowerbed curb repairs or touch-ups in Brandon, MS range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and materials needed.

Standard Installation - Installing new flowerbed curbing in a typical residential setting often costs between $1,000 and $2,500. Most projects in this category are straightforward and fall comfortably within this range.

Larger or Complex Projects - Larger, more intricate curb installations or extensive landscaping projects can reach $3,500-$5,000 or more. Fewer projects push into this higher tier, usually due to custom designs or challenging terrain.

Full Replacement - Replacing an existing flowerbed curb entirely generally costs between $2,000 and $4,500. The final price varies based on the size of the area and the materials selected by local contractors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is flowerbed curbing installation? Flowerbed curbing installation involves creating a defined border around garden beds using materials like concrete, stone, or plastic to enhance landscape appearance and prevent soil erosion.

What materials are commonly used for flowerbed curbing? Common materials include concrete, brick, stone, plastic, and metal, each offering different aesthetic and durability options for landscape borders.

How do local contractors install flowerbed curbing? Local service providers typically prepare the area, choose appropriate materials, and install the curbing with proper finishing techniques to ensure a clean, durable border.

Can flowerbed curbing be customized to match existing landscaping? Yes, many local contractors offer customization options in materials, colors, and styles to complement existing garden and landscape features.

Is flowerbed curbing suitable for all types of gardens? Flowerbed curbing can be installed in various garden types, including residential, commercial, and decorative landscapes, depending on the desired aesthetic and functional needs.

Define garden boundaries - Installing flowerbed curbing helps clearly mark garden areas, preventing grass or weeds from encroaching on flowerbeds.

Enhance curb appeal - Well-installed curbing creates a neat, finished look that can improve the overall appearance of a property's landscape.

Prevent soil erosion - Curbs can help contain soil and mulch within flowerbeds, reducing erosion during heavy rains or watering.

Create a low-maintenance landscape - Flowerbed curbing can reduce the need for ongoing edging work, making garden upkeep easier.
